Are you an experienced MDS nurse interested in the next step? The MDS Coordinator provides oversight of the RAI process and conducts assessments and care plan coordination for guests.

Responsibilities:

  • Completes the MDS, CAA’s and care plans within regulated time frames.
  • Coordinates scheduling the RAI process with the interdisciplinary team.
  • Assesses resident through physical assessment, interview and chart review.
  • Discusses resident care needs with care givers, including physician, nursing, social services, therapy, dietary, and activity staff.
  • Reviews information from hospital, consults and outside agencies and uses such information in the completion of the assessment and care planning.
  • Coordinates, identifies, and/or initiates significant change MDS.
  • Is prepared to conduct PPS meetings maintaining MDS assessments per Medicare schedule and maintains PPS board for monitoring of Medicare days and RUGs utilization in the absence of the Care Management Coordinator.
  • Remains current with American Association of Nursing Assessment Coordinators (AANAC) requirements.

Qualifications

  • Registered Nurse (RN) or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) licensure.
  • AANC certification a plus. RAC-CT.
  • Knowledge of the Resident Assessment Instrument (RAI) process, including the principles the Prospective Payment Process (PPS) strongly preferred.
  • Experience as an MDS Nurse.
